Transaction 39e433d9068588165f73fb846dc8caad79e47972bee885faecc2b2448ba69766
2 Input
2 Outputs
- 39e433d9068588165f73fb846dc8caad79e47972bee885faecc2b2448ba69766:0
- 39e433d9068588165f73fb846dc8caad79e47972bee885faecc2b2448ba69766:1
value 16900000
address 15Jka9dPLEw1JAYPeRD2tYngZfUT48zCAX
value 28430920
address 1AXZMMSpcJpoXJnVmkd8jAtDHbg27i4jCe